Description
- VSCode Version: 1.54.3
- Local OS Version: macOS 11.2.3 (20D91)
- Remote OS Version: Ubuntu 20.04.2 LTS
- Remote Extension/Connection Type: SSH
Steps to Reproduce:
- initiate a connection to remote host riscv64 machine
- try to decode why the remote host architecture is not supported - the traceback is not very clear as to what's missing. Is there a way to make this print out the dependency that is not present or is this failing due to a missing entry in a whitelist that is checking the output of
uname -m
